Markusturm and Röderbogen are located within the historic old town of Rothenburg ob der Tauber, which is largely pedestrianized. If arriving by car, park outside the town walls and walk in. The towers are easily found by following the main streets from the market square. Reddit

While there isn't direct public transport to the towers themselves within the pedestrian zone, buses and trains will get you to Rothenburg. From the train station, it's a pleasant walk into the old town where the towers are situated. Reddit

Driving is restricted within the old town. It's best to park in designated car parks outside the medieval walls and enjoy a walk into the heart of Rothenburg, where Markusturm and Röderbogen are located. Reddit

The most enjoyable way to explore is on foot. Wear comfortable shoes as the cobblestone streets can be uneven. The towers are central points for discovering the charming alleys and other landmarks. Reddit

The Historic Significance of Markusturm & Röderbogen

The Markusturm and Röderbogen are integral parts of Rothenburg ob der Tauber's formidable medieval fortifications. The Markusturm, a prominent tower, stands as a testament to the town's defensive past, often featuring a distinctive clock. Adjacent to it, the Röderbogen forms part of the impressive town gate system, allowing passage through the ancient walls. These structures are not merely architectural relics; they are living history, offering a tangible connection to the centuries of life and defense within Rothenburg's embrace. Instagram+1

These landmarks are situated within the inner walls of Rothenburg, a town renowned for its exceptionally well-preserved medieval character. The Röderbogen, in particular, is often captured in photographs as part of the Röderanlage, a section of the fortifications that provides scenic views and walking paths. Exploring these towers and gates allows visitors to appreciate the strategic importance of Rothenburg and the ingenuity of its medieval builders. Instagram

Many visitors find that simply walking around and absorbing the atmosphere is the best way to experience these sites. The Romantik Hotel Markusturm, located nearby, further emphasizes the historical immersion of the area, with its own centuries-old foundations.
